Charmaine Hedding joined the Operation Blessing team as the National Director of Israel in January 2009.
Born and educated in South Africa, Charmaine lived in Jerusalem in the 1980s and again since 2004.
In her previous work with different faith-based and government groups she has focused on a number of women’s issues including domestic violence, trafficking, incest, female mutilation, and honor killings.
In her role with OB Israel, Charmaine oversees a number of programs including: assisting elderly Holocaust survivors living below the poverty line; providing humanitarian and legal assistance for women and children victims of trafficking; aiding new immigrants and migrant workers; providing job skills and educational training for asylum seekers, including assisted voluntary repatriation of South Sudanese families; and coordinating faith-based groups in Israel to assist in disaster relief initiatives both in-country and abroad.
In the West Bank and Palestinian territories, Charmaine and the OB Israel team are offering job skills training for disabled adults, including support for physically disabled children; holding general medical, optical and dental outreaches; and distributing food and other humanitarian assistance for impoverished families. |
